Job Description

Egis has been working in Romania for almost 30 years, providing engineering and consultancy services in road and rail transport sectors as well as water and environment, energy, urban development and other institutional advisory services.

Egis is a global consulting and engineering firm working in construction, transport and mobility services. Our mission: create and operate intelligent infrastructure and buildings to further the transition to a low-carbon economy and contribute to more balanced and sustainable territorial development.   • Request the design theme if it is not attached to the Contract or there are no Terms of reference
  • Prepares bid requests for subcontractors and presents them to the Department Manager
  • Participate in the design activity in order to respect the deadline established by the contract and the design schedule
  • Prepares technical design solutions within the project
  • Prepares the technical plans and the written parts of a project in accordance with the content framework of the design phase in which he participates
  • Make the technical documentation available to the technical checkers
  • Evaluation of the quality of materials and workmanship, implementation of QA/QC procedures, verification of shop drawings
  • Make field visits within the projects
  • Intervenes when it finds that the requested technical or temporal requirements are not met, finding solutions to remedy them without prejudice to the project
  • Prepares external intermediate reports, if they have been requested by the topic
  • Actively participates in the technical part of the solution
  • Participate in ensuring relations with the Beneficiary and subcontractors
  • Participate in ensuring relations with local administrations, utility beneficiaries, the external project verifier and all institutions directly or indirectly involved in the development of the project
  • Participates and supports (depending on experience and delegation) the approvals along the way and the final approval
  • Participates and supports the notices to the Beneficiary or to the issuers of notices (depending on experience and delegation)
  • Ensures communication with subcontractors in order to respect the established delivery deadlines
  • Check the documentation received from subcontractors for their inclusion in the established terms of reference
  • Hand over the project to the Beneficiary
  • Participate in the monitoring of projects during execution
  • Maintain confidentiality in relation to all actions, materials and information, the disclosure of which could harm the company and/or employees of Egis Romania
  • Up to date with news in the field, the application of new technologies and design methods performed.
  • Participate in the preparation of the technical offer

About Egis

Egis is a leading global architectural, consulting, construction engineering, operations and mobility services firm. We create and operate intelligent infrastructure and buildings that both respond to the climate emergency and contribute to balanced, sustainable and resilient development.

Our 22,000 employees operate across over 100 countries, deploying their expertise to develop and deliver cutting-edge innovations and solutions for clients. Through the wide range of our activities, we are central to the collective organisation of society and the living environment of citizens all over the world.
